在物聯(lián)網(wǎng)技術(shù)日新月異的今天,國(guó)內(nèi)涌現(xiàn)出了一批優(yōu)秀的開(kāi)源物聯(lián)網(wǎng)平臺(tái),它們各自憑借獨(dú)特的技術(shù)優(yōu)勢(shì)和應(yīng)用場(chǎng)景,在推動(dòng)物聯(lián)網(wǎng)行業(yè)發(fā)展方面發(fā)揮著重要作用。JetLinks、Maxdoop、DC3、FastBee以及HummingBird,就是其中的佼佼者。
JetLinks作為國(guó)內(nèi)物聯(lián)網(wǎng)基礎(chǔ)平臺(tái)的代表,以其強(qiáng)大的設(shè)備全生命周期管理和多協(xié)議適配能力著稱。它支持MQTT、TCP、UDP等多種主流協(xié)議,并能通過(guò)邊緣網(wǎng)關(guān)接入異構(gòu)設(shè)備,實(shí)現(xiàn)千萬(wàn)級(jí)設(shè)備連接和復(fù)雜場(chǎng)景的智能聯(lián)動(dòng)。JetLinks還提供了實(shí)時(shí)數(shù)據(jù)處理引擎和可視化規(guī)則引擎,使得數(shù)據(jù)處理延遲低于30ms,同時(shí)支持多渠道通知。該平臺(tái)采用Java 8、Spring Boot等先進(jìn)技術(shù)棧構(gòu)建,支持Docker容器化部署和Kubernetes集群擴(kuò)展,確保了高性能與高并發(fā)。
而Maxdoop則是一款以“低代碼+全協(xié)議兼容”為核心的企業(yè)級(jí)物聯(lián)網(wǎng)快速開(kāi)發(fā)平臺(tái)。它內(nèi)置了30多種協(xié)議庫(kù),支持JS腳本自定義解碼,能夠適配西門(mén)子PLC、海康攝像頭等非標(biāo)設(shè)備。Maxdoop還提供了可視化組態(tài)界面和代碼生成器,支持拖拽式搭建數(shù)據(jù)大屏和業(yè)務(wù)流程,極大地提高了開(kāi)發(fā)效率。該平臺(tái)采用微服務(wù)模塊化設(shè)計(jì),支持按需選擇功能模塊,降低了部署成本。同時(shí),它還提供了按鈕級(jí)權(quán)限控制和數(shù)據(jù)加密傳輸?shù)劝踩胧_保了系統(tǒng)的安全可靠。
DC3則是一款基于Spring Cloud的分布式開(kāi)源物聯(lián)網(wǎng)平臺(tái),它強(qiáng)調(diào)高可伸縮性和容錯(cuò)性,適合中大型項(xiàng)目的跨平臺(tái)部署與定制化開(kāi)發(fā)。DC3采用了“驅(qū)動(dòng)層-數(shù)據(jù)層-管理層-應(yīng)用層”的四層架構(gòu),實(shí)現(xiàn)了設(shè)備驅(qū)動(dòng)的獨(dú)立封裝和動(dòng)態(tài)加載。該平臺(tái)支持Windows、Linux、Docker等多種環(huán)境部署,并提供了高可靠數(shù)據(jù)傳輸和多平臺(tái)部署能力。DC3還采用了微服務(wù)架構(gòu)和服務(wù)熔斷、降級(jí)機(jī)制等容錯(cuò)措施,確保了系統(tǒng)的穩(wěn)定運(yùn)行。
對(duì)于中小企業(yè)和個(gè)人開(kāi)發(fā)者來(lái)說(shuō),F(xiàn)astBee無(wú)疑是一個(gè)簡(jiǎn)單易用的輕量級(jí)物聯(lián)網(wǎng)平臺(tái)。它以“簡(jiǎn)單易用”為核心設(shè)計(jì)理念,提供了標(biāo)準(zhǔn)化物模型和低代碼設(shè)備接入功能,使得開(kāi)發(fā)者無(wú)需編寫(xiě)代碼即可完成傳感器、智能家電的接入。FastBee還內(nèi)置了多種場(chǎng)景模板,如智能家居、農(nóng)業(yè)監(jiān)測(cè)等,覆蓋了80%的常見(jiàn)物聯(lián)網(wǎng)場(chǎng)景。該平臺(tái)支持Windows/Linux本地部署和Docker鏡像快速啟動(dòng),資源占用低,適合邊緣網(wǎng)關(guān)、樹(shù)莓派等硬件資源有限的場(chǎng)景。
最后,HummingBird作為一款面向工業(yè)物聯(lián)網(wǎng)的輕量級(jí)開(kāi)源平臺(tái),以其輕量化、低功耗的特點(diǎn)受到了廣泛關(guān)注。它支持在邊緣節(jié)點(diǎn)對(duì)原始數(shù)據(jù)進(jìn)行預(yù)處理,減少了云端傳輸帶寬。同時(shí),HummingBird還優(yōu)化了MQTT-SN、CoAP協(xié)議,適配了低功耗設(shè)備如NB-IoT、LoRa傳感器等。該平臺(tái)提供了實(shí)時(shí)數(shù)據(jù)看板和插件化擴(kuò)展功能,使得開(kāi)發(fā)者可以方便地添加新協(xié)議解析器并適配不同工業(yè)傳感器。HummingBird的邊緣節(jié)點(diǎn)可運(yùn)行于資源受限設(shè)備如ARM開(kāi)發(fā)板,云端則支持容器化部署,確保了系統(tǒng)的靈活性和可擴(kuò)展性。